Lawmakers hit 
gas on red light camera repeal 
Just a year after lawmakers passed a law 
legalizing red light cameras at traffic intersections, a new crops of 
legislators wants to slam on the brakes. 
The House Appropriations 
Committee Wednesday voted 12-9 to repeal the law passed a year ago that has led 
municipalities across the state to install red lights at traffic intersections. 
Rep. Richard Corcoran, R-Trinity, the House sponsor of the bill, said 
that there have been numerous problems with the cameras and many counties are 
throwing out traffic cases spurred by red light camera photos. 
“Let’s 
step back and figure out a way where we can make these intersections safer for 
our communities,” he said. 
Law enforcement has lined up against the bill 
though, saying the cameras are cutting down on serious accidents in their 
communities. Many lawmakers, citing concerns from their local sheriffs, said 
they could not vote for the repeal, particularly since it had not been in effect
